Bulldogs Lose Conference Matchup to Saints


Lisette Ayala (#19 Dean) and Sydney Gonzalez (#18 Emmanuel) battle for a ball during their game on Wednesday (Image courtesy of Dean Athletics)














FRANKLIN – The Dean Women’s Soccer team fell to the Emmanuel Saints 6-1 in a GNAC (Great Northeast Athletic Conference) matchup on Wednesday afternoon. Dean was looking to get back in the win column after tying with Lasell 0-0 in their previous game, while Emmanuel was looking to win their fifth straight game after defeating Anna Maria 4-0 in their previous contest.


Dean got on the board a little over five minutes into the first half when Junior forward Lisette Ayala scored her second goal of the season to put the Bulldogs up 1-0. Emmanuel would tie the score about eight minutes later when Sophomore midfielder Liz McCormick scored her third goal of the season to tie the score up at one.


Emmanuel then added four more goals in the first half as Sophomore midfielder Maya Dayanani, Junior midfielder Rachel Harrington, Sophomore defender Annebel Balogh de Ga, and Junior forward Kaelyn Briscoe all got on the score sheet for the Saints, giving them a 5-1 lead heading into halftime.


The Saints added another goal with just over thirteen minutes left in the second half when first-year forward Ciara Horan scored her second goal of the season, to increase their lead to 6-1.


With the win, the Saints improve their record to 5-1 (4-0 GNAC) and will look to keep up their good play when they host a conference matchup against Simmons on Saturday. Meanwhile, Dean falls to a record of 3-3-1 (2-2-1 GNAC) and will look to bounce back when they travel to New Hampshire for a non-conference matchup against the New England College Pilgrims, also on Saturday, September 23rd at 1:00 p.m.
